Obituary For John G. Rossiter
John G. Rossiter, Jr., of Rockland died on January 26, 2009 at the South Shore Hospital after a long illness. He was born in Dorchester son of the late John G. and Alice L. (Bruce) Rossiter, Sr and was raised and educated there. He made his home in Cambridge for several years before moving to Rockland in 1993. Jack was a veteran of the U.S. Army. He graduated from Northeastern University with a BS degree in finance and began his career with the MIT Instrumentation Laboratory as a technician and he retired in 1993 as a civilian employee of the U.S. Navy Department at the Draper Laboratories in Cambridge. While employed there he met his wife Deborah A. (Grace) Rossiter and they enjoyed 25 years of marriage together. He enjoyed spending time with his wife, James Bond, family and collecting wine In addition to his wife he is survived by a sister, Annette Dobin of CA. He was also the nephew of the late Annie Bruce.
